What is the cheapest month to fly from Leeds to the Philippines?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Leeds to the Philippines,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Leeds to the Philippines is June, when tickets cost £668 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and July, when the average cost of return tickets is £1,331 and £1,097 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Leeds to the Philippines?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Leeds to the Philippines with an airline and back with another airline.
